summaryrefslogtreecommitdiff
path: root/pkgtools/Makefile
AgeCommit message (Collapse)AuthorFilesLines
2017-02-17Initial addition of pkgtools/pkg_comp-cron, version 1.0:jmmv1-1/+2
This package sets up periodic builds of binary packages using the pkgtools/pkg_comp utility given minimal configuration. All that is needed from the user is to determine which packages to build automatically. If you are on NetBSD, see also sysutils/sysbuild-user, which is the perfect companion to this package to periodically build the base system.
2017-02-17Readd pkg_comp, now at version 2.0:jmmv1-1/+2
**Released on 2017-02-17.** This is the first release of the pkg_comp project as a standalone package. This new release shares no code with previous versions and is not compatible with them. The following are the major differences between pkg_comp 2.0 and all previous releases, which incidentally are the reasons that triggered this rewrite: * Support for multiple platforms. * Use of pbulk to (re)build packages within the sandbox. This results in more reliable incremental builds after pkgsrc updates. * Support for bootstrap, generating binary kits as part of the builds. * Better scriptability to allow running from cron(8) trivially.
2017-02-12Move pkgtools/pkg_comp to pkgtools/pkg_comp1.jmmv1-2/+2
This is to make room for pkg_comp 2.0, which is coming soon. The new release is significantly different from the 1.x series in features (supports multiple platforms, bootstrap, and pbulk) but also comes with a different configuration syntax.
2016-10-01Add pkgtools/plist-utilskamil1-1/+2
2016-01-24Add texlive2pkgmarkd1-1/+2
2015-11-25Reimported pkglint-4.518 from pkgtools/pkglint as pkglint4rillig1-1/+2
The Perl version of pkglint (pkglint<5.0) runs on all platforms that are supported by pkgsrc. Not so the Go version (pkglint>=5.0). To support development of packages on all platforms, this version is provided, and it will be supported equally. Its output differs a bit from pkglint>=5.0, but the basic checks are the same.
2015-11-22Add and enable gimmeagc1-1/+2
2015-08-17Remove xpkgwedge, not needed any longer.wiz1-2/+1
2015-07-04Add pkgkhorben1-1/+2
2015-04-25Initial import of the R2pkg package.brook1-1/+2
2014-09-17+ cwrappersjoerg1-1/+2
2014-04-27Add and enable genpkgngagc1-1/+2
2013-08-15Remove pkgtools/tinderbox-dragonflymarino1-2/+1
This package is no longer in use, and is far behind upstream now. It is heavily customized so maintenance is far from trivial. There were no objections to the announcement of my intentions to remove this package which I made on package-users@ a month ago. I feel it is better to retire this package than allow it to bitrot further.
2012-08-26+ mksandbox.wiz1-1/+2
2012-02-02add and enable pkg_p5up2datejnemeth1-1/+2
2011-11-03add and enable tinderbox-dragonflyjnemeth1-1/+2
2011-05-18+distbb, oked by sponsorscheusov1-1/+2
2011-05-16Add nih, approved by sponsorscheusov1-1/+2
2011-05-16Add pkg_online client and server, approved by sponsorscheusov1-1/+3
2011-05-11+pkg_summary-utils, oked by sponsorscheusov1-1/+2
2010-04-30Added pkgtools/osabisbd1-1/+2
2009-08-30+ pkgsrc-todo.wiz1-1/+2
2009-06-08add & enable pkginimil1-1/+2
2009-06-07Split pbulk into pbulk-base (the backend programs) and pbulk (rest).joerg1-1/+2
2009-01-08+ packagekit gnome-packagekitjmcneill1-1/+3
2009-01-04+pkg_distinstadrianp1-1/+2
2008-06-06Sort.wiz1-2/+2
2008-05-24Added pkgtools/compat_headerstnn1-1/+2
2008-05-23Remove pkgtools/posix_headerstnn1-2/+1
2008-05-15+ pkg_leavesjoerg1-1/+2
2008-03-06Note removal of tnftp and pax.jlam1-3/+1
2008-01-03+ lintpkgsrcrillig1-1/+2
2007-08-13Added mk/misc/category.mk, which contains the definitions that are onlyrillig1-2/+2
useful for category Makefiles, as opposed to bsd.pkg.subdir.mk, which is also relevant for the top-level directory. Adjusted the category Makefiles.
2007-06-19Added pbulk.joerg1-1/+2
2007-04-24Note addition of pkgtools/posix_headers.tnn1-1/+2
2007-03-02Remove pkgmanpages packages, the information contained in it has beenwiz1-2/+1
integrated in the pkgsrc guide.
2006-12-05add pkg_rolling-replacegdt1-1/+2
2006-08-18Remove comments, because printindex cannot handle them.wiz1-3/+3
2006-08-17Uncomment directories which had no reason given for being commented out.wiz1-8/+8
2006-07-17Add sysutils/install-sh and pkgtools/bootstrap-extras.jlam1-1/+2
2006-07-14Add but don't enable bootstrap-mk-files. We don't enable because this isjlam1-1/+2
a key bootstrap package.
2006-07-14Create a separate pkgtools/tnftp package that is installed as part ofjlam1-1/+2
the bootstrap process and which may be needed by pkg_install. This is distinct from the net/tnftp package that is now a "normal" package. Modify the bootstrap script to use pkgtools/tnftp instead, and clean up some of the registration code.
2006-07-14Create a separate sysutils/mtree package that is a "normal" package,jlam1-2/+2
distinct from the pkgtools/mtree package which is installed as part of the bootstrap process and which may be needed by pkg_install.
2006-07-14Create a separate "pax" package in the pkgtools category that installsjlam1-1/+2
into ${PKG_TOOLS_BIN}. This package is used in the case where pax is a requirement for the pkg_install tools. The archivers/pax package is now a normal package with no special PKG_PRESERVE flags set.
2006-05-28Remove EOL comments for packages which were uncommented; theywiz1-3/+3
confused make.
2006-05-26After some discussion with jlam and no objection raised by agc,joerg1-4/+4
uncomment libnbcompat, mtree and xpkgwedge.
2005-11-13Add and enable p5-pkgsrc-Dewey.wiz1-1/+2
2005-10-01Add and enable verifypc.jmmv1-1/+2
2005-09-16Removed distfetch from pkgsrcmartti1-2/+1
2005-07-30Remove pkgconflict here too.wiz1-2/+1